Output 3cc154d80f2bf42f69fc7cd3605824a875d6a2ea80062c82f968cab0456178ac:4

value
243568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6762b0ae5e09097ad1e4cbcf54fe0ee68132d389 OP_EQUAL
address
3B7fkR1r3in5T9XJCteSaCA5VqBcq6cK4T
transaction
3cc154d80f2bf42f69fc7cd3605824a875d6a2ea80062c82f968cab0456178ac
spent
true